Transaction 807418dc523afda36ba0bbd59e98141c1560c3e1b1406a5870edd53d8f0cefea
1 Input
1 Output
-
807418dc523afda36ba0bbd59e98141c1560c3e1b1406a5870edd53d8f0cefea:0
- value
- 13815270
- script pubkey
- OP_0 OP_PUSHBYTES_20 4920e17c3c0743b21b08bff9fbebff0869b59f57
- address
- bc1qfyswzlpuqapmyxcghlulh6llpp5mt86hgn3zll